The Moors introduced cannabis to Spain in the 8th-century occupation. The Spanish, consequently, took marijuana on the Americas wherever it absolutely was generally made use of as being a funds crop for making hemp fiber.

Archaeologists unearthed traces of cannabis with higher levels of THC (the key psychoactive component of cannabis) in wood bowls courting to 500 bce during the Jirzankal Cemetery in China, marking the earliest occasion of cannabis use discovered to this point. This specific usage of marijuana was much more likely for just a spiritual rite than medicinal functions, though religion and medicine weren't automatically stored different.

THC is transformed and broken down with the liver. Some drugs enhance how speedily the liver improvements and breaks down THC. This may alter the effects and Negative effects of THC.
